Possible Causes of a Water Leak Under the House

One common cause of water leaks underneath a house is aging or damaged plumbing pipes. Over time, pipes can develop cracks, corrosion, or loose fittings that allow water to escape and accumulate below the foundation. These issues are often caused by natural wear and tear, especially in older homes or properties with poorly maintained plumbing systems.

Another frequent culprit is groundwater seepage or heavy rainfall overwhelming drainage systems. When the soil around a homeโ€™s foundation becomes saturated, water can find its way through tiny cracks or gaps in the foundation walls or floor. Over time, this persistent moisture can lead to significant water pooling below the house, creating potential risks for structural integrity and mold growth.

How do I know if my house has a leak under it?

If you notice unexplained dampness, mold growth, a sudden increase in water bills, or pooling water around your foundation, these could be signs of a hidden leak. Our professional inspection can help confirm if a leak is present and determine its severity.

What can I do to prevent future water leaks underneath my house?

Regular inspections of plumbing and foundation walls, maintenance of gutters and drainage systems, and installing sump pumps or waterproof barriers help prevent future issues. Our team offers tailored recommendations to protect your property long-term.
